Reinert Breaks All-Time Hits Record, Alvernia Splits with Lycoming

Reading, Pa. (April 24, 2022) - Alvernia University (12-16) split its Sunday series with Lycoming College (8-22) and Sarah Reinert became the Alvernia all-time hits leader in game two on Sunday afternoon in non-conference softball action at Alvernia.

Sarah Reinert tied the record at 202 with a double to lead off Alvernia in game two. She then recorded her 203rd career hit with a single through the right side in her second at-bat of game two. Reinert surpassed Miranda Peto '13, who recorded 202 hits in 170 games during her career.

Reinert reached the milestone in 156 career games. She was an All-American and MAC Commonwealth Player of the Year in 2021 and was named a NFCA Top-50 Player to Watch earlier this season. 

Alvernia took game one by a 3-2 decision before dropping game two 10-9 after Lycoming College completed a come-from-behind win. 

In game one of the afternoon, Alvernia fell behind 2-0 after the top of the third, but got one back in the bottom half of the inning. Reinert doubled to left field in the second at-bat of the inning and stole third during the next at-bat. On a Maggie Loomis sacrifice fly to shallow left field, Reinert took off on the tag. The throw appeared to beat her, but the catcher dropped the ball as Reinert scrambled back to tag home.

Alvernia trailed 2-1 until the bottom of the fifth. Reinert reached on a fielding error and stole second to get into scoring position. Jaclyn Barbera drove in Reinert to even the game up at 2-2 on a double to left field. Megan Poley then scored on an error during Allison Kirschner's at-bat to give Alvernia the 3-2 lead.

The Golden Wolves held Lycoming to one hit the rest of the way as Alvernia took the 3-2 win.

Maggie Loomis picked up the win in the circle for Alvernia with the complete game showing.

Barbera led Alvernia with two hits and one RBI.

In game two of the afternoon, Reinert got things started with a leadoff double in the bottom of the first for career hit 202. Reinert then scored on an infield single by Payton Lascalla, and Barbera scored Alvernia's second run of the inning on a double by Hope Robinson. 

Alvernia extended its lead to 5-0 in the bottom of the second. With two on and two out, Barbera drove a three-run homer over the right center fence to give Alvernia the 5-0 advantage. 

Lycoming got one back in the top of the third, but Alvernia tacked on four to its lead in the bottom of the third frame. Emma Kropkowski tripled to right field to bring in Robinson. Reinert then recorded her record-breaking hit to bring in Kropkowski on a single through the right side. Two more runs then scored on an error during Tara Tumasz's at-bat to give Alvernia the 9-1 lead.

Lycoming got four back in the top of the fourth and added another run in the top of the fifth to get back within three, 9-6. The Warriors didn't stop there as they added four more in the top of the seventh to take the lead. The Warriors took the lead on a two-run homer to go up 10-9.

Alvernia did not get a runner on in the bottom of the seventh as Lycoming took the 10-9 win.

Reinert, Barbera, and Robinson each finished with two hits, and Barbera finished with three RBIs.
